In his latest blog, Marc Márquez looks forward to another home race but a new track after getting back to winning ways at Misano in the San Marino round of the 125cc MotoGP world championship two weeks ago.

Hello!

Again we are in a race week. And a special week – we are in luck, because this year we have one more grand prix in Spain. This is good news for us!

We’re looking forward to it, and are very, very motivated, because we went back to winning ways in Misano, and that gives us even more energy to work to get the best set-up for Friday onwards. This is always the key – we must focus on it so we start from the front again, fighting for victory. And hopefully the weather will respect us so we can all enjoy the weekend!

‘I’m convinced that we’ll all have a great weekend!’

About the course in Aragon… a couple of months ago, I had the opportunity, along with other riders, to have a private practice there for two days, and what we found was a very nice circuit to ride, and also very technical.

It’s a very twisty track with many ups and downs. For example, one of the chicanes is quite uneven to the point that it resembles the corkscrew at Laguna Seca, but with a less steep incline. So they say, but of course I haven’t yet had the opportunity to race at Laguna Seca!

I’ll take my leave for now and look forward seeing my fans in the stands, enjoying the circuit and the race. I’m convinced that we’ll all have a great weekend!
